The History of Cuban Chains
Cuban chains have a rich and vibrant history that traces back to the streets of Havana. This style grew popular in the 1970s, gaining traction within hip-hop culture. Artists and influencers embraced these bold, chunky designs as symbols of wealth and status.
Originally crafted from gold or silver, Cuban chains are distinguished by their interlocking links that create a striking visual appeal. They embody both strength and elegance, making them versatile accessories for various occasions.
As time passed, this jewelry style transitioned into mainstream fashion. Today’s designs often feature modern twists while honoring traditional craftsmanship. The allure of Cuban chain jewelry continues to captivate new generations who appreciate its heritage and unmistakable flair.
This unique fusion of cultural significance and artistic expression makes Cuban chains more than just mere accessories—they’re statements that tell stories through generations.
Different Types of Cuban Chains
Cuban chains come in various styles, each with its own unique flair. The classic Cuban link chain features interconnected oval links that create a smooth and durable design. This timeless piece is popular for both casual and formal occasions.
Another type is the Miami Cuban chain, known for its thicker links and more pronounced shine. It adds a bold statement to any outfit, making it a favorite among hip-hop enthusiasts.
For those looking for something lighter yet equally stylish, there’s the lightweight Cuban chain. Its delicate construction maintains elegance while still showcasing the iconic link pattern.
Custom options are also available, allowing artisans to infuse personal touches or mix materials like gold and silver. Each variation brings out different aspects of this beloved jewelry style, appealing to diverse tastes and preferences.
Why 3D Modeling for Cuban Chain Jewelry?
3D modeling has revolutionized the jewelry industry, particularly for Cuban chain designs. This technology allows jewelers to visualize intricate details before production. Precision is key in creating that signature look of a Cuban chain.
Using 3D models enables designers to experiment with various styles and sizes effortlessly. You can see how different materials will interact without committing to physical samples first.
Moreover, customization becomes easier with 3D printing methods. Clients can request personalized chains that reflect their unique tastes and preferences, making each piece special.
This approach also speeds up the design process. Designers can quickly iterate on ideas and make adjustments based on client feedback without losing time or resources.
The integration of advanced software tools means you can create stunning visualizations that captivate potential buyers online. Engaging graphics draw customers in and help them envision wearing these beautiful pieces themselves.
How to Choose the Right 3D Model for Your Jewelry Business
Selecting the right 3D model for your jewelry business requires careful consideration. Start by understanding your target audience and their preferences. What styles appeal to them? Modern, classic, or perhaps something edgy?
Next, evaluate the quality of the 3D models available. Look for intricate details and realistic textures that can elevate your designs. High-resolution files will ensure a polished final product.
Don’t forget about versatility. Choose models that can be easily modified or adapted to fit different sizes and materials. This flexibility allows you to cater to various customer needs without starting from scratch each time.
Consider compatibility with your production process. Ensure the chosen model works seamlessly with your 3D printing equipment or any other manufacturing methods you’re using in-house or through partners. This alignment is crucial for maintaining efficiency and minimizing errors during production.
